
We’ve asked all of the candidates standing for election to Cheshire West and Chester Council to provide our readers with a short introduction to themselves.
We’ll publish these daily for all 45 council wards (in alphabetical order) in the build up to the local elections on 4th May 2023.
You can view all of the Cheshire West and Chester Council candidate submissions together by clicking here.
Listed below are all of the candidates seeking your vote in the Malpas ward.
Voters in Malpas can select one candidate to represent them on Cheshire West and Chester Council.
Malpas candidates:
- Stephen Burns (Labour)
- Charles Higgie (Liberal Democrats)
- Rachel Williams (Conservatives)
